
Stephen Harron made it a hat trick of Paddy Byrne titles following a 6-2 defeat of two time champion Andrew Gillespie in a repeat of the 2023 final, to round of a great day of darts with 64 players entering. Stephen beat 1996 champion JP Byrne and Andrew beat 2018 champion Cartha Boyle in the semis, while in the quarters Stephen had a tough battle with Menchia, Andrew defeated Declan Quinn while JP beat Stephen Muirhead and Cartha was a 5-0 winner over 2011 champion Kieran Carr. In the youths final Corey O'Donnell beat Ryan McGinley.
